Genesis 4:17

Made Simple — Modern English Translation

Translated by Verse Made Simple Editorial
KJV ORIGINAL
And Cain knew his wife; and she conceived, and bare Enoch: and he builded a city, and called the name of the city, after the name of his son, Enoch.
Close to the original. Clear modern English.
✦ MADE SIMPLE

Cain slept with his wife, and she became pregnant and gave birth to Enoch. Cain built a city and named it Enoch after his son.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

This verse shows Cain starting a family and establishing the first city mentioned in the Bible, naming it after his son Enoch.

📚 Historical Context

This verse comes shortly after Cain murdered his brother Abel and was banished by God to wander the earth. Despite his punishment, Cain is shown building civilization - establishing the first city mentioned in Scripture. The building of cities represented the beginning of organized human society and culture separate from the simple agricultural life that had existed before.
